- Technical Experience: N/A Role Specific Responsibilities
- Conduct a focused nursing assessment and contribute to the ongoing comprehensive nursing assessment of the patient performed by the registered professional nurse
- Collaborate in the development and modification of the registered professional nurse’s or advanced practice registered nurse’s comprehensive nursing plan of care for all types of patients
- Implement aspects of the plan of care
- Participate in health teaching and counseling to promote, attain, and maintain the optimum health level of patients
- Serve as an advocate for the patient by communicating and collaborating with other health service personnel
- Participate in the evaluation of patient responses to interventions
- Communicate and collaborate with other health professionals
- Provide input into the development of policies and procedures to support patient safety
- Evaluates patient progress and reports changes to RN, supervisor and/or physician.
- Complete, accurate, and timely documentation in patient medical record
- Timely completion of required education, competencies, and licensure. Applicable to Perioperative service line LPN’s in OR/Procedure Room
- Assists the physician with procedures.
- Assists with cleaning, decontaminating, sterilization and storage of equipment and instruments.
- Assists in transportation and positioning of patients
- Assists in assembling and dismantling of tables and instruments before and after procedure
- Prepares patient and room for the planned surgical procedures.
- Opens sterile supplies and sets up for procedures
- Completes skin preparation and draping
- Assist Surgeon with gowning and gloving
- Assist surgeon by passing instruments and suture
- Assists in maintaining correct count of instruments, sutures, and sponges
- Applies dressings and bandages as needed
- Assists in identifying, collecting, and caring for specimens.
- Decontaminates instruments (point of use cleaning), supplies and equipment according to established policies and procedures; handles and stores instruments, equipment and supplies appropriately
- Aids in the efficient turnover of the operating room for next cases
